To provide a thorough response, it would be helpful to know the specific options you have in mind regarding the influences on the reform of Medellín, Colombia. However, I can give you some general factors that have influenced reforms in Medellín:

1. **Social and Economic Inequality**: High levels of inequality and poverty have prompted reforms aimed at improving access to education, healthcare, and job opportunities for marginalized communities.

2. **Violence and Crime**: The history of violence, particularly during the time of drug cartels led by figures like Pablo Escobar, has pushed authorities to implement security reforms and invest in social programs to reduce crime.

3. **Urban Planning and Infrastructure**: The need for better urban planning and public transportation has led to significant infrastructure projects, such as the Medellín Metro and cable cars, which connect the city with poorer neighborhoods.

4. **Community Participation**: Grassroots movements and community organizations have played a crucial role in advocating for social change, emphasizing the importance of citizen engagement in the decision-making process.

5. **Public Policy and Governance**: Changes in local governance, including the adoption of innovative public policies, have been crucial in addressing the challenges faced by the city.

6. **International Focus and Support**: Global recognition of Medellín's issues has led to partnerships with international organizations and governments that provide funding and expertise for urban development projects.

7. **Cultural Transformation**: Cultural initiatives that promote arts and education have been critical in altering the city’s image and fostering a sense of pride and community.
